Well, an 8 footer would take up less length than a 6, so better for transport.

Yep. My 6ft single spindle cutter is the same length as my 10ft dual spindle.

My research tells me a lift type cutter has more benefits in tight spots than a pull behind?
Seems I'm finding more pull behind twin spindles?

My 10ft dual spindle is 3pt lift type. It's a load on my M9540. I add 1000lb of suitcase weights to the front of the tractor. But for most of my use I like the maneuverability.

Opinions on this 8' lift super duty Rhino? Seems to be well built and offer great cutting capacity for a multi spindle lift style cutter.
 
   / Kubota M7060 #60  
Looks good and a low enough price. My deere mx7 was 4k and is rated for 2". It weights 1332 lbs. it has a double deck with each one being 10 ga. I don't know how manufactures come up with ratings whether it's based off the gear box or deck/side skirt thickness. I'm washing I had gotten an 8' now over my 7' due to being easier on the tractor and shorter length.
